HT3965 How does do I change the name of my iPhone in iTunes11?

The new iTunes11 has changed the layout of the sidebar. It is not possible to directly change the name of the iphone/ipod. Does anyone know how this is done in the new version?

Hi.
1) Click on 'Devices'. 
2) Locate your iPhone.
3) Click once on the image - this will open up to show the contents of your iPhone (much the same as it used to)
4) Click once on the name of your iPhone.  This will make the name editable.
5) Click 'Done' to finish and save.
